# Agent Brief: Harb Stack
## Core Concepts
- KRAIKEN couples Harberger-tax staking with a dominant Uniswap V3 liquidity manager to create asymmetric slippage, sentiment-driven pricing, and VWAP "price memory" safeguards.
- Liquidity dominance is mission-critical; treat any regression that weakens the LiquidityManager's control as a priority incident.
- Harberger staking supplies the sentiment oracle that drives Optimizer parameters, which in turn tune liquidity placement and supply expansion.

## Operating the Stack
- Start everything with `nohup ./scripts/local_env.sh start &` and stop via `./scripts/local_env.sh stop`. Do not launch services individually.
- Supported environments: `BASE_SEPOLIA_LOCAL_FORK` (default Anvil fork), `BASE_SEPOLIA`, and `BASE`. Match contract addresses and RPCs accordingly.
- The stack boots Anvil, deploys contracts, seeds liquidity, starts Ponder, launches the landing site, and runs the txnBot. Wait for logs to settle before manual testing.

## Testing & Tooling
- Contracts: run `forge build`, `forge test`, and `forge snapshot` inside `onchain/`.
- Fuzzing: scripts under `onchain/analysis/` (e.g., `./analysis/run-fuzzing.sh [optimizer] debugCSV`) generate replayable scenarios.
- Integration: after the stack boots, inspect Anvil logs, hit `http://localhost:42069/graphql` for Ponder, and poll `http://127.0.0.1:43069/status` for txnBot health.
## Guardrails & Tips
- `token0isWeth` flips amount semantics; confirm ordering before seeding or interpreting liquidity.
- VWAP, `ethScarcity`, and Optimizer outputs operate on price^2 (X96). Avoid "normalising" to sqrt inadvertently.
- Fund the LiquidityManager with Base WETH (`0x4200...0006`) before expecting `recenter()` to succeed.
- Ponder stores data in `.ponder/`; drop the directory if schema changes break migrations.
